Agartala, January 22, 2019: The Assam Police on Monday night arrested at least 30 Rohingya of seven families, including 12 children from Churaibari village near the Tripura border. It is learnt, these Rohingya arrived in Tripura by train around four months ago. They were arrested while moving to Guwahati North Tripura District Police chief Bhanupada Chakraborty said, “The Assam police have arrested 30 Rohingya Muslims from a Guwahati-bound bus at Churaibari along the inter-state border on Monday night.” The group, with nine women, had boarded from Agartala.
Meanwhile, a group of 31 Rohingya Muslims, including 16 children, who remained stuck near the India-Bangladesh border in Western Tripura after both countries refused to accept them – were detained by BSF and later Police arrested those. Medical tests were conducted and they would be produced at Court today, OC Amtali PS Pranab Sengupta said.
